Witryna29 paź 2012 · High levels of psychological distress can predict attrition in high-risk populations, such as psychiatric outpatients and former hospitalized patients [3, 14]. In population-based studies, psychological distress has been found to have no effect or a weak to moderate effect on attrition after adjusting for other variables [2, 4, 9, 10 ...
